Agile business analysis requires a unique skill set and adaptable mindset. Analysts must partner development teams, iteratively modifying requirements to meet the ever-changing needs of the project. Successful Agile analysts are dynamic, continuously communicating with stakeholders and endorsing value delivery throughout the agile lifecycle.
- Employing user stories, backlog grooming, and sprint planning are essential practices.
- Assessing requirements based on business value and stakeholder input ensures coherence with project goals.
- Continuous feedback loops allow for adjustment and course correction, driving continuous improvement.
By embracing these practices and cultivating a supportive work environment, business analysts can advance in Agile Business Analysis fundamentals the fast-paced world of Agile development.

Agile BA: Bridging the Gap Between Business and Technology
In today's fast-paced business environment, it is crucial to have a clear link between the business aims and the technology that implements them. This is where the task of an Agile BA comes in. An Agile BA acts as a link, conveying complex business requirements into workable user stories that developers can develop.
By cultivating collaboration between the business and technical teams, Agile BAs help to ensure that projects are delivered on time, within budget, and that they actually meet the needs of the users.
- Some Tasks of an Agile BA include:
- Carrying out business requirement gathering and analysis.
- Documenting user stories and acceptance criteria.
- Collaborating with stakeholders to define product backlog items.
- Conducting sprint planning, daily stand-ups, and retrospectives.
